Objective

3.04 Explain simple project presentation techniques appropriate for residential and non-residential design.

Outline/Vocab (on your course outline sheet)

A. Portfolios B. Presentation boards C. ModelsD. Drawings and renderings

Portfolios

Professional: Collection of current and past work Renderings, drawings, and photos Review monthly for newer or better quality

work Student: A scrapbook of learning

Shows learning, effort, progress, and achievement

Various types Print Website Powerpoint

Presentation Boards

Contain: Floorplans Elevations Furniture and Product Selections Samples Renderings Anythig necessary to help client visualize

finished product!

Presentation Boards

Presentation Boards

Models

Miniature, 3-D representations of a design idea

To scale

Drawings

Perspectives- drawing from a point of view Exterior Interior

Floorplans- Vary in style and content Elevations- shows a view perpendicular

to surface Sections- Cutaway view of the

interior/exterior

Perspective

Floor Plans

Elevations

Sections

Renderings

Addition of shades, shadows, texture and color to a line drawing to achieve a realistic appearance. Pencil Ink Watercolor Colored Pencil Felt-tip marker (prisma) Applique Airbrush Computer Generated
